Factors Influencing Fat Removal
Several factors influence how much belly fat can be safely removed during a liposuction procedure. These include the patient's overall health, the amount of fat present, and the elasticity of the skin. Generally, a single session of liposuction can remove up to 5 liters of fat, but this is highly variable and depends on the individual's circumstances.
Safety and Risks
Safety is paramount in any medical procedure, and liposuction is no exception. Over-aggressive removal of fat can lead to complications such as skin irregularities, fluid imbalance, and even organ damage. Therefore, it's crucial to have realistic expectations and to work closely with a qualified plastic surgeon who can assess your specific situation and recommend the appropriate course of action.

Understanding Liposuction and Its Limits
Liposuction is a popular cosmetic procedure designed to remove excess fat from specific areas of the body, including the abdomen. However, it's important to understand that liposuction is not a weight-loss solution but rather a method for contouring and refining body shape. The amount of belly fat that can be removed with liposuction in Halifax, or anywhere else, depends on several factors.
Factors Influencing Fat Removal
Several key factors determine how much fat can be safely removed during a liposuction procedure:
Patient's Health: A thorough medical evaluation is essential to ensure the patient is in good health and a suitable candidate for liposuction. Conditions such as diabetes, heart disease, or blood clotting disorders can affect the safety and outcome of the procedure.
Skin Elasticity: The quality and elasticity of the skin play a crucial role. Patients with good skin elasticity are more likely to achieve a smooth, natural-looking result after fat removal.
Fat Distribution: The amount of fat that can be removed is also influenced by the distribution and density of fat in the abdominal area. Some patients may have more localized fat deposits, while others may have a more diffuse distribution.
Surgeon's Expertise: The skill and experience of the surgeon are paramount. A qualified and experienced plastic surgeon will carefully assess each patient's unique situation and determine the safest and most effective approach to fat removal.
Safety and Volume of Fat Removal
The safety of the patient is the top priority during any surgical procedure, including liposuction. Generally, it is considered safe to remove up to 5 liters of fat during a single session. However, this is a guideline and not a strict rule. The actual amount of fat that can be removed will vary based on the patient's individual circumstances and the surgeon's judgment.
